Carbon Capture and Storage: Designing the Legal and Regulatory Framework for New Zealand

Summary/Abstract

This Report is concerned with the legal framework for geological storage or sequestration of carbon dioxide (CO2). The aim of the research is to provide a comprehensive framework for the development of law and policy to govern CCS in New Zealand. The methodology involved an analysis of the existing law and policy as it applies to CCS, assessment of any barriers, and a comparison with law in selected other jurisdictions. That analysis was followed by discussion of different policy options and evaluation of the possibility of addressing CCS in the existing legal framework. Recommendations were made for law reform on each aspect of the subject.
